Output c3f43a19bad28b984a572b52be3a0b6c5f52db3c84ede62a4fa734a7ec01b094:1

value
930613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542653bf4574888bbe354e1235d408bff4eab32b OP_EQUAL
address
39Mxbg2ZnVeMghJyToenVzngEUhCwShcnc
transaction
c3f43a19bad28b984a572b52be3a0b6c5f52db3c84ede62a4fa734a7ec01b094
confirmations
267305
spent
true